Areas of interest

  • Land-atmosphere interactions.
  • Hybrid ecohydrological modelling combining physics and machine learning.
  • Satellite remote sensing of terrestrial evaporation.
  • Self-reinforcing phenomena in the Earth system.

Research projects

LAMDA: Land–atmosphere interactions as a mechanism of dryland formation. Funded by the European Research Council Starting Grant (2027–2032).

Background

Akash is climate scientist with expertise in the broad domain of land–atmosphere interactions. His research primarily combines atmospheric transport models with physics and machine learning principles to uncover how feedback between vegetation and climate shape each other at timescales of days to millennia. He is currently leading an European Research Council (ERC) Starting Grant project on developing a new theory on dryland formation.

Akash completed his PhD at the University of California, Los Angeles (UCLA), United States, in 2019. He subsequently worked as a postdoctoral scientist in Germany (Helmholtz Center for Environmental Research), Belgium (Ghent University), and Switzerland (EPFL). Before joining the University of Reading in 2026, he was a tenure-track assistant professor in the University of Maryland, College Park in the United States.
